Considering the dimensions of rectangle have got integer values we can get a solution.

If #x# cm represents the common multiple of dimension of the rectangle then

a) Area of the 1st rectangle

#=6x*5x=20*6#

#=>x=2#

This gives dimension as #12cmxx10cm#

b) Area of the 2nd rectangle

#=4x*3x=20*6#

#=>x=sqrt10#

This gives dimension as #4sqrt10cmxx3sqrt10cm->color(red)"not possible"#

c) Area of the 3rd rectangle

#=15x*2x=20*6#

#=>x=2#

This gives dimension as #30cmxx4cm#

d) Area of the 4th rectangle

#=30x*x=20*6#

#=>x=2#

This gives dimension as #60cmxx2cm#
